Flaming Star Nebula

from £30.00

The Flaming Star Nebula is an emission and reflection nebula located approximately 1,500 light-years away in the northern constellation Auriga. The nebula surrounds the hot blue variable star AE Aurigae. The nebular material that looks like smoke is mostly composed of hydrogen, with dark filaments made up of carbon-rich dust.
